ARMENIAN SPEAKER MET WITH PACE PRESIDENT

10.09.2005 03:50

/PanARMENIAN.Net/ Armenian Parliament Speaker Artur Baghdassaryan being on
visit in US met with President of the Parliamentary Assembly of the Council
of Europe (PACE) Rene Van Der Linden, reported the Press Service of the
Armenian National Assembly (NA). The PACE President noted the importance of
wide propaganda before the referendum and efficient implementation of
constitutional reforms. Within his visit to New York A. Baghdassaryan met
with Czech Parliament Chairman Lubomir Zaoralek, Swiss Speaker Therese
Meyer, Japanese Speaker Chikage Oogi, Brazilian Speaker Severino Cavalcanti
and Chairman of the Parliament of Jordan Abdullah Majali. Agreement to
establish interparliamentary relations were achieved. A. Baghdassaryan
expressed confidence the establishment of interparliamentary relations will
promote bilateral cooperation in diverse fields, international cooperation,
as well as correct comprehension of Armenia’s problems. In the course of the
Armenian Speaker’s meeting with President of the House of Representatives of
Cyprus Demetris Christofias it was agreed to erect a monument to victims of
the Armenian Genocide in Larnak. It should be noted that after his New York
meetings A. Baghdassaryan returned to Yerevan.
